Chemical Identifiers
CAS7342-82-7
IUPAC Name3-bromo-1-benzothiophene
Molecular FormulaC8H5BrS
InChI KeySRWDQSRTOOMPMO-UHFFFAOYSA-N
SMILESBrC1=CSC2=CC=CC=C12
View more
SpecificationsSpecification SheetSpecification Sheet
Refractive Index1.6640-1.6700 @ 20?C
Identification (FTIR)Conforms
Appearance (Color)Clear colorless to yellow to red
FormLiquid
Assay (GC)≥94.0%

Applications
Antifungal activity of synthetic di (hetero) arylamines based on the benzo [b] thiophene moiety.

Solubility
Sparingly Soluble (0.14 g/L) (25°C).

Notes
Store in cool place. Keep container tightly closed in a dry and well-ventilated place. Store away from strong oxidizing agents.
